    Wrestlenomics reports that the March 1st episode of AEW Dynamite brought in an average overnight audience of 833,000 viewers. They scored a .27 in the 18 to 49 demographic. This was a big drop in viewership after so many tuned in for Tony Khan’s big announcement.

    Considering that was the go home show for a PPV has to be worrying.
